
Composés deutérés
Les composés deutérés sont des molécules organiques dans lesquelles un ou plusieurs atomes d'hydrogène sont remplacés par du deutérium, un isotope stable de l'hydrogène. Ces composés sont essentiels dans divers domaines scientifiques, notamment la spectroscopie RMN, la spectrométrie de masse et les études cinétiques d'isotopes. Les composés deutérés améliorent la clarté et la précision des signaux dans les analyses en réduisant le bruit de fond et en offrant des perspectives uniques sur les mécanismes réactionnels et les structures moléculaires.
